Output d91abfb8d4ca36fbe13405b3f28c6b34498498287d1485da0f02249479c04597:18

value
1000000000
script pubkey
OP_0 OP_PUSHBYTES_20 300132d95f7b5fbbbcff0d9a55f658bcb7d161a4
address
bc1qxqqn9k2l0d0mh08lpkd9tajchjmazcdyzp64qp
transaction
d91abfb8d4ca36fbe13405b3f28c6b34498498287d1485da0f02249479c04597
spent
true